Annotated Snippet
#ifndef __SOC_V1_0_ENUM_H__
#define __SOC_V1_0_ENUM_H__
typedef enum MTYPE {
MTYPE_NC = 0x00000000,
MTYPE_RESERVED_1 = 0x00000001,
MTYPE_RW = 0x00000002,
MTYPE_UC = 0x00000003,
} MTYPE;
typedef enum SH_MEM_ALIGNMENT_MODE {
SH_MEM_ALIGNMENT_MODE_DWORD = 0x00000000,
SH_MEM_ALIGNMENT_MODE_UNALIGNED = 0x00000001,
} SH_MEM_ALIGNMENT_MODE;
#endif
